27 total · sorted by risk| CVE | Vendor / Product | Sev | Risk | CVSS | EPSS | KEV | Published | Description |
|---|---|---|---|---|---|---|---|---|
| CVE-2026-33615 | Cri | 0.59 | 9.1 | 0.00 | Apr 2, 2026 | An unauthenticated remote attacker can exploit an unauthenticated SQL Injection vulnerability in the setinfo endpoint due to improper neutralization of special elements in a SQL UPDATE command. This can result in a total loss of integrity and availability. | ||
| CVE-2026-14948 | Hig | 0.57 | 8.8 | 0.00 | Aug 20, 2026 | A low privileged remote attacker can hijack an active administrative session without needing to know the administrator password by extracting live plaintext session identifiers for authenticated users from downloadable error log archives. | ||
| CVE-2026-35082 | Hig | 0.57 | 8.8 | 0.00 | Jun 3, 2026 | The ugw-logread method allows a remote attacker with user privileges to access arbitrary local files due to insufficient validation of user-supplied input. | ||
| CVE-2025-41726 | Hig | 0.57 | 8.8 | 0.00 | Jan 27, 2026 | A low privileged remote attacker can execute arbitrary code by sending specially crafted calls to the web service of the Device Manager or locally via an API and can cause integer overflows which then may lead to arbitrary code execution within privileged processes. | ||
| CVE-2025-41684 | Hig | 0.57 | 8.8 | 0.01 | Jul 23, 2025 | An authenticated remote attacker can execute arbitrary commands with root privileges on affected devices due to lack of improper sanitizing of user input in the Main Web Interface (endpoint tls_iotgen_setting). | ||
| CVE-2025-41683 | Hig | 0.57 | 8.8 | 0.01 | Jul 23, 2025 | An authenticated remote attacker can execute arbitrary commands with root privileges on affected devices due to lack of improper sanitizing of user input in the Main Web Interface (endpoint event_mail_test). | ||
| CVE-2026-40851 | Hig | 0.55 | 8.4 | 0.00 | May 27, 2026 | A local attacker can perform a confusion attack on the cfgparser via a specially crafted file on an USB stick leading to code execution. This can result in a total loss of confidentiality, integrity and availability. | ||
| CVE-2026-35081 | Hig | 0.53 | 8.1 | 0.00 | Jun 3, 2026 | The ugw-logstop method allows a remote attacker with user privileges to terminate arbitrary processes due to insufficient validation of user-supplied input. | ||
| CVE-2026-35079 | Hig | 0.53 | 8.1 | 0.00 | Jun 3, 2026 | The ugw-restore method allows a remote attacker with user privileges to delete arbitrary local files due to insufficient validation of user-controlled input. | ||
| CVE-2026-35078 | Hig | 0.53 | 8.1 | 0.00 | Jun 3, 2026 | The ugw-logstop method allows a remote attacker with user privileges to delete arbitrary local files due to insufficient validation of user-controlled input. | ||
| CVE-2026-8046 | Hig | 0.53 | 8.1 | 0.00 | May 26, 2026 | The affected products insufficiently verify authorization when deleting user accounts. An authenticated, low-privileged remote user can exploit this vulnerability to delete other users, including those with higher privileges. | ||
| CVE-2026-44469 | Hig | 0.51 | 7.8 | 0.00 | May 26, 2026 | The affected product extracts installation files to a temporary directory with incorrect default permissions during administrative installation. A low-privileged local attacker can exploit a TOCTOU race condition with a practical time window to replace verified files with… | ||
| CVE-2026-44468 | Hig | 0.51 | 7.8 | 0.00 | May 26, 2026 | The affected product creates a directory with insecure default permissions during administrative installation. This allows a low-privileged local attacker to modify a temporary file defining the components to be installed, enabling local privilege escalation by forcing the… | ||
| CVE-2025-41727 | Hig | 0.51 | 7.8 | 0.00 | Jan 27, 2026 | A local low privileged attacker can bypass the authentication of the Device Manager user interface, allowing them to perform privileged operations and gain administrator access. | ||
| CVE-2026-40813 | Hig | 0.49 | 7.5 | 0.00 | May 27, 2026 | An unauthenticated remote attacker can exploit an unauthenticated SQL Injection vulnerability in the getLiveValues functions tagid parameter due to improper neutralization of special elements in a SQL SELECT command. This can result in a total loss of confidentiality. | ||
| CVE-2026-40811 | Hig | 0.49 | 7.5 | 0.00 | May 27, 2026 | An unauthenticated remote attacker can exploit an unauthenticated SQL Injection vulnerability in the ssoabstractservice due to improper neutralization of special elements in a SQL SELECT command. This can result in a total loss of confidentiality. | ||
| CVE-2026-8047 | Hig | 0.49 | 7.5 | 0.00 | May 26, 2026 | The affected products perform improper length checking when parsing incoming HTTP requests, resulting in a size-limited out-of-bounds write. An unauthenticated remote attacker can exploit this flaw to cause a denial of service via a system crash on the affected device. | ||
| CVE-2026-14947 | Hig | 0.47 | 7.2 | 0.01 | Aug 20, 2026 | A high-privileged remote attacker can upload malicious ZIP archive containing directory traversal sequences such as ../ can escape the intended extraction directory and write files to arbitrary locations on the server, potentially achieve arbitrary code execution due to improper… | ||
| CVE-2026-10521 | Hig | 0.47 | 7.2 | 0.01 | Jun 23, 2026 | An high privileged remote attacker can access a hidden configuration method, that should not be accessible by any user, to modify critical program parameters. This can result in a total loss of confidentiality, integrity and availability. | ||
| CVE-2026-40852 | Hig | 0.47 | 7.2 | 0.00 | May 27, 2026 | A highly authenticated attacker can alter the config generator injecting a payload into future created configurations. The device is not correctly checking this configuration value before passing it to an system execute leading to code execution. This can result in a total loss… | ||
| CVE-2026-33613 | Hig | 0.47 | 7.2 | 0.01 | Apr 2, 2026 | Due to the improper neutralisation of special elements used in an OS command, a remote attacker can exploit an RCE vulnerability in the generateSrpArray function, resulting in full system compromise. This vulnerability can only be attacked if the attacker has some other way to… | ||
| CVE-2026-33617 | Med | 0.34 | 5.3 | 0.00 | Apr 2, 2026 | An unauthenticated remote attacker can access a configuration file containing database credentials. This can result in a some loss of confidentiality, but there is no endpoint exposed to use these credentials. | ||
| CVE-2026-40826 | Med | 0.32 | 4.9 | 0.00 | May 27, 2026 | A high privileged remote attacker can exploit an unauthenticated SQL Injection vulnerability in the dsgvo_contracts view due to improper neutralization of special elements in a SQL SELECT command. This can result in a total loss of confidentiality. | ||
| CVE-2026-7849 | Cri | 0.00 | 9.8 | 0.00 | Jul 30, 2026 | Due to improper neutralization of special elements, an unauthenticated remote attacker is able to inject a command into the system configuration which is subsequently executed as root. | ||
| CVE-2026-44104 | Cri | 0.00 | 9.8 | 0.00 | Jul 30, 2026 | The firmware update process for the basemodule of the charging controller only validates the CRC32 checksum without cryptographic signature verification. This allows an unauthenticated remote attacker to install a modified firmware, resulting in full system compromise. | ||
| CVE-2026-44097 | Hig | 0.00 | 7.1 | 0.00 | Jul 30, 2026 | A low-privileged remote attacker with "operator" access can upload arbitrary files via the REST endpoint intended for firmware updates, resulting in persistent storage of attacker-controlled files and potentially exhausting resources, which might lead to Denial-of-Service. | ||
| CVE-2026-14448 | Hig | 0.00 | 7.2 | 0.01 | Jul 20, 2026 | An high privileged remote attacker can exploit an authenticated OS command injection vulnerability in the system_certificates view due to improper neutralization of special elements in an OS command. This can result in a total loss of confidentiality, availability and integrity. |
